Beispiel #1
0
 def test_challenge_closed(self):
     open_tag = "challenge:%s" % make_challenge_tag()
     closed_dt = datetime.date.today() - datetime.timedelta(days=32)
     closed_tag = "challenge:%s" % closed_dt.strftime("%Y:%B").lower()
     assert not challenge_utils.challenge_closed([open_tag])
     assert challenge_utils.challenge_closed([closed_tag])
Beispiel #2
0
 def challenge_closed(self):
     challenge_tags = self.taggit_tags.all_ns('challenge:')
     if not challenge_tags or 'challenge:none' in map(str, challenge_tags):
         return False
     return challenge_utils.challenge_closed(challenge_tags)
Beispiel #3
0
 def challenge_closed(self):
     challenge_tags = self.taggit_tags.all_ns('challenge:')
     if not challenge_tags or 'challenge:none' in map(str, challenge_tags):
         return False
     return challenge_utils.challenge_closed(challenge_tags)
Beispiel #4
0
 def test_challenge_closed(self):
     open_tag = 'challenge:%s' % make_challenge_tag()
     closed_dt = datetime.date.today() - datetime.timedelta(days=32)
     closed_tag = 'challenge:%s' % closed_dt.strftime('%Y:%B').lower()
     assert not challenge_utils.challenge_closed([open_tag])
     assert challenge_utils.challenge_closed([closed_tag])
Beispiel #5
0
 def challenge_closed(self):
     challenge_tags = self.taggit_tags.all_ns('challenge:')
     if not challenge_tags:
         return False
     return challenge_utils.challenge_closed(challenge_tags)